Skip to Content

Web Klausur


In der letzten Vorlesungen wurden folgende Themen aufgelistet:

  • Lastenheft (Praktikum 1) ✅
  • Pflichtenheft (Praktikum 2) ✅
  • CiviCRM (Praktikum 3)
    • Begriffe erklären
  • Aufbau HTML-Seite
    • Struktur ✅
    • Semantik
    • Erklären können ✅
  • Client und Server
    • Wie kommt ein Dokument vom Server zum Client ✅
    • Skizze erstellen ✅
    • Blickwinkel 1 (Beschreiben Sie) ✅
    • Stylesheets
  • Was macht HTML, CSS, JavaScript ✅
    • Erklären können mit einem Satz ✅
  • World Wide Web ✅
  • HTML
    • Versionen ✅
    • Elemente und Attribute (Beispiele / Unterschiede) ✅
    • Block und Inline Elemente ✅
  • Ted Nelson ✅
  • TLS ✅
    • Skizzieren ✅
  • Fehlertolerenz ✅
    • Warum arbeiten Browser anders als Code (Compiler) ✅
    • Wie reagiert der Browser. Wie wird gehandelt ✅
    • Warum braucht es Fehlertoleranz ✅
  • Browser
    • Umfang (Browser komplexer als Linux Kernel) ✅
    • Was macht ein Browser ✅
    • Tali Garsiel: How Browsers work
    • DOM Tree und Render Tree ✅
  • Seiten Layout mit Table
    • Aufbau ✅
    • Tabellen mit Javascript
  • Formulare
    • Aufbau ✅
    • Methoden ✅
    • Input Elemente ✅
  • Event Handler ✅
    • Was ist das ✅
    • Beispielcode ✅
    • Anwendungsfälle ✅
  • Event Listener ✅
  • JavaScript Aufgaben ✅
    • Ergebnisse erkennen ✅
    • Datentypen ✅
      • Reihenfolge der Bearbeitung ✅
  • JavaScript
    • Einbau in HTML ✅
    • Wo kommt javaScript her ✅
    • Gefährlich? ✅
  • Code Lokal oder Server ✅
    • Unterschiede ✅
    • Vorteile ✅
  • Windows Funktion ✅
    • Größe des Browserfensters erkennen ✅
  • Browserleaks durchgehen ✅
  • innerHTML und textContent ✅
  • Attribute eines Elements ändern ✅
    • Suchen Sie XY Element und verändern Sie dieses ✅
  • Array und Objekte ✅
  • DOM
    • Was ist das ✅
    • Was kann man machen ✅
    • Wie funktioniert die Navigation ✅
    • Begriffe KÖNNEN
  • AJAX ✅
    • Was passiert da ✅
    • asynchronität ✅
  • AJAX Backend ✅
    • Was für Request gibt es (GET, PUSH, PUT, DELETE) ✅
  • HTTP (Hyper Text Transfer Protocol) ✅
    • HTML Error Codes (200 OK, 404 Not Found, 500 Internal Server Error) ✅
    • URI ✅
  • Abkürzungen können
  • CSS
    • Welche Selektoren und was machen die ✅
    • CSS Übung von 15. Jan ✅
    • Warum “background-color” in CSS und “backgroundColor” in JavaScript ✅
    • Stylesheet Aufbau ✅
    • Beispiele nennen und erklären ✅
    • Operatoren (Sehr genau angucken) ✅
      • Leerzeichen, ., >, + ✅
    • Spezifität ✅
    • width, height, padding, margin, border ✅
    • Border Box und Content Box ✅
    • inline-block ✅
  • Fonts ✅
    • Styles, Gewicht, Größe ✅
    • Welche gibts ✅
    • Google Fonts ✅
    • Wie wendet man die an ✅
    • WOFF2, TTF, OTF ✅
  • Responsive Web Design ✅
    • Was ist das ✅
    • Benötigt HTML und CSS ✅
    • @media Querys ✅
      • Media Features ✅
        • Beispiele angucken
  • flex und grid ✅
    • Unterschiede ✅
    • Anwendungsfälle ✅
    • Welchen Zweck ✅
  • Absichern von Client und Server ✅
  • HTTP vs HTTPS
    • TLS-Handshake ✅
      • Ablauf ✅
      • Wie funktioniert dieser ✅
    • Wo ist symetrische und asymetrische Verschlüsselung im Einsatz ✅
    • TLS-Zertifikat ✅
      • LetsEncrypt ✅
      • Domain Validierung, Organisation Validierung ✅
  • CMS
    • Hugo
    • Dynamisch vs Statisch
  • Proxy Server ✅
    • Reverse Proxy ✅
    • Forward Proxy ✅

9 Teile

Last updated on